## Spindlewheel Rebalancer — quick notes

Hey future maintainer: the rebalancer pulls dock fill levels every five minutes and spits out van routes for the overnight crew. If Harborton's east docks look permanently "full," it's usually the stale-snapshot bug — just restart the ingest worker before panicking. Routes get pushed to the internal DispatchNest service, which is picky about auth and will silently drop unauthenticated payloads. When you set up a fresh environment, configure the worker with the service credential that follows.

service key, fawip-bajef: kto11_Qt5wZK9vdNC

## Configuration

The ChipGate reader service for the Dunlow Marathon series reads its settings from a single `.env` file in the install directory. Standard options — antenna polling interval, mat identifiers, and the results upload interval — are documented in `docs/settings.md` and can usually stay at their defaults. The upload endpoint, however, requires an authentication credential issued by the Stridewell results platform, and the service refuses to start without it. In the `.env` file, add the following line:

sealed setting: ARCHIVE_KEY3=8d0

## Who to ping about GiftNote

Welcome aboard! GiftNote is our donation-receipt mailer for the Larchfield Fund. Template tweaks go to the comms folks; delivery failures and bounce weirdness go to the platform crew. Don't push template changes on Fridays — receipts batch over the weekend. For anything GiftNote-related, start with the address below.

billing contact of kaweg-tajeg = drudor.lamion.oliath@torvalabs.test